Which landscape size best predicts the influence of forest cover on restoration success? A global meta‐analysis on the scale of effect
Abstract
Summary Landscape context is a strong predictor of species persistence, abundance and distribution, yet its influence on the success of ecological restoration remains unclear. Thus, a primary question arises: which landscape size best predicts the effects of forest cover on restoration success?
